Comparing 3D Vision Cameras: Orbbec Gemini 335 vs. Intel RealSense D435i

In today's era of rapid technological advancement, 3D vision technology plays a pivotal role across diverse fields, including industries, robotics, and artificial intelligence. Among the key players in this market are the Orbbec Gemini 335 and Intel's RealSense D435i. This article provides a comprehensive comparative analysis of these two popular stereo 3D cameras.

 

I. Overview of Orbbec Gemini 335

The Gemini 335, a standout model in Orbbec's Gemini 330 series, is designed to deliver high-quality depth perception data across various lighting conditions and environments. Its high-performance active-passive fusion stereo imaging system and multiple sensors enable it to perform exceptionally well indoors, outdoors, and in dynamic scenarios.


Key Features:

  • Dual Imaging Technology: The LDM projects an infrared speckle pattern in low-light conditions to enhance texture, ensuring stable depth data capture.
  • Superior Performance Across Environments: In direct sunlight, both infrared and natural light are harnessed for optimal imaging.

II. Intel RealSense D435i: High-Performance Depth Camera

The Intel RealSense D435i represents a high-performance depth camera series equipped with dual RGB and infrared sensors, providing accurate depth perception without the need for a laser range-finding module.

 

III. Performance Comparison: Testing Across Various Scenarios

1. Outdoor Imaging Performance

Scenario: Captured outdoor scenes under sunny conditions.

Both cameras effectively managed to deliver reliable depth maps despite the high sunlight intensity, with comparable depth effects.

2. Imaging in Complex Environments

Scenario: Various objects were placed against a white wall indoors.

The Gemini 335 outperformed the RealSense D435i in stability and completeness of depth imaging, especially for objects with repetitive or weak textures.

3. Field of View (FOV) Comparison

Scenario: Captured images of numbers on an optical calibration board.

The Gemini 335 demonstrated a wider field of view, capturing more detail vertically and horizontally compared to the RealSense D435i.

RealSense D435i Depth and RGB FOV parameters

Gemini 335 Depth and RGB FOV parameters

Additionally, the Gemini 335 supports both hardware and software Depth-to-Color (D2C) functionalities, allowing for pixel-level spatial alignment of depth and color data. In contrast, the D435i requires higher computational power for its software-based D2C implementation.

4. Motion Scene Imaging

Scenario: Both cameras were evaluated while rapidly moving to capture images of a patterned paper.

The Gemini 335 exhibited significantly lower motion blur compared to the RealSense D435i, making it more suitable for dynamic imaging tasks.

Application Scenarios

The compact design and IP5X rating of the Gemini 335 make it ideal for various applications, including collaborative robots, shelf robots, and AI vision development. Its robust performance in complex environments strongly supports the advancement of AI and robotics.
